  • Publication number: 20230073472
    Abstract: Aspects of the disclosure provide a method of tilting characterization. The method includes measuring a first tilting shift of structures based on a first disposition of the structures. The structures are formed in a vertical direction on a horizontal plane of a product. A second tilting shift of the structures is measured based on a second disposition of the structures. The second disposition is a horizontal flip of the first disposition. A corrected tilting shift is determined based on the first tilting shift and the second tilting shift.

  • Publication number: 20120122765
    Abstract: Apoptosis inducing factor (“AIF”) contains a PAR-binding motif (“PBM”) that binds to Poly(ADP-ribose) (“PAR”). Binding of PAR to AIF via the PBM is required for AIF release from the mitochondria to occur, and that this PAR-related release is a key step in the programmed cell death process known as parthanatos, both in vitro and in vivo. Preventing or disrupting this release can inhibit parthanatos and thus be the basis for treatments for patients suffering from diseases or medical conditions during which parthanatos commonly occurs, including Parkinson's disease or diabetes, or patients who have had and are recovering from heart attack, stroke and other ischemia reperfusion-related injuries. Alternatively, agents could be identified that enhance the release of AIF, thereby promoting parthanatos and serving as potential anti-tumor chemotherapeutic agents.
